Shuckers dream
Edit April 2021: These models are now the WD80EDAZ variants, these are air filled and not helium. There are reports of these drives running at 7200rpm and not 5400rpm. They also run about 5c-10c hotter than their helium counterparts. If you don't plan on shucking these, it's ideal to put a fan on the enclosure to keep the drive cool as it can reach 60c under load. No issues with mine in a server chassis that provides air cooling for my drives.Original review:These are great for shucking (helium variant inside). The warranty from Australia is a little unclear however and the price needs to be readjusted to the sales that occur in the US. Contact WD after registering your drive to receive a free AU power adapter.Edit: I contacted WD to query the "out of region" warranty. They informed me that the drives will still remain under warranty and that you can claim the warranty within Australia.
